| Rosa chinensis Jacq. var spontanea(Rehd. et Wils.) Yî’ et Ku is the wild species of Rosa chinensis. Rosa chinensis Jacq.’Old Blush’and Rosa chinensis Jacq.’Slater’s Crimson China’are the most parentages for modern rose cultivars with characteristic of recurrent flowering. Rapid Propagation of the former two roses and regeneration system of Rosa chinensis Jacq var. spontanea (Rehd. et Wils.) Yî’ et Ku were established for rose gene sequencing and transformation.Stems with auxiliary buds of roses were used as explants. MS+2.5 mg/L 6-BA+0.1 mg/LNAA was chosen as the best initial medium; For Rosa chinensis Jacq. var. spontanea (Rehd. et Wils.) Yî’ et Ku,MS+6.0 mg/L 6-BA+0.03 mg/LNAA was the most efficient proliferation medium; MS +0.25mg/L NAA as the most suitable rooting medium; While for Rosa chinensis Jacq.’Old Blush’, MS+4.0 mg/L 6-BA+0.03 mg/L NAA and 1/2MS +0.25mg/L NAA was the best proliferation medium and rooting medium.MS+6.0mg/L 2,4-D was the best callus induction medium for Rosa chinensis Jacq. var. spontanea (Rehd. et Wils.) Yî’ et Ku, and the induction rate was 79.59%; While MS+1.5mg/L NAA+300mg/L L-proline+2.4g/L Gel was most suitable for Rosa chinensis Jacq.’Old Blush’with a rate of 27.91%; The most efficient one for Rosa chinensis Jacq.’Slater’s Crimson China’was MS+4.0 mg/L 2,4-D and induction rate was 20.00%.For Rosa chinensis Jacq. var. spontanea (Rehd. et Wils.) Yî’ et Ku,the somatic embryogenesis can be obtained on MS+3.0mg/L 2,4-D+2.0mg/LTDZ after 12dculture in dark; MS+2.0mg/L 6-BA+ 0.1mg/L NAA was best for somatic embryogenesis maintenance, the induction rate was 30.00%; Somatic embryogenesis can germinate on 1/2MS+2.0mg/L6-BA+0.1mg/L NAA when the PPFD is 150 mol·m-2·s-1. |
